Re: [Ovillo] onContextMenu

2005-04-20 Por tema Choan C. Gálvez
De Marco Recuenco, Angel Daniel escribió:
Hola!
os quería preguntar si es posible deshabilitar por medio
de estilos el menú contextual que se activa con el botón
derecho del ratón; 
Respuesta corta: no, no se puede.
Respuesta larga: deshabilitar mi botón derecho supone un atentado en 
toda regla contra mi libertad como usuario. (¿Y qué mayor violencia que 
la que se ejerce contra el espíritu?)

Por otra parte, así a bote pronto, diría que `onContextMenu` es un 
evento propietario de IE y, en cualquier caso, si pretendes proteger 
algo mediante dicho truquillo, no lo vas a conseguir.

Salud,
Choan
PS: Si te apetece mandar alguna URL que aplique dicha técnica, estaré 
encantado de demostrarte que no sirve de nada.

el caso es que la cosa funciona si en la etiqueta body de
la página le escribes onContextMenu=return false.. esto se
puede escribir en el estilo body de alguna forma para que no
haya que ponerlo en todas las páginas?
gracias.
--
Mundo Du. Cuentos breves, relatos sorprendentes
http://du.lacalabaza.net/
Dizque. Cosas que me van y me vienen
http://dizque.lacalabaza.net/
___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://ovillo.org/mailman/listinfo/ovillo


RE: [Ovillo] onContextMenu

2005-04-20 Por tema De Marco Recuenco, Angel Daniel
bueno bueno.. como estamos con los atentados a la libertad,
supongo que deshabilitar las ventanillas de un coche para 
evitar que los niños hagan un uso peligroso es bueno para
la libertad de los niños y de los demás..
en cualquier caso lo que te quería decir es que el diseño web 
no sólo se hace para servicios de caracter público, existen 
multitud de aplicaciones de cliente ligero que se desarrollan 
para ser manejadas mediante un navegador en la que las acciones de
los usuarios están estrictamente determinadas,así las funciones 
propias de los navegadores no sólo no son útiles, sino que son 
innecesarias, los navegadores están pensados para muchas 
cosas.. y para muchas menos.

de todas formas agradezco tu respuesta a mi pregunta, el resto
me ha parecido ocioso y parcial.



-Mensaje original-
De: [EMAIL PROTECTED]
[mailto:[EMAIL PROTECTED] nombre de Choan C. Gálvez
Enviado el: miércoles, 20 de abril de 2005 13:45
Para: Ovillo, la lista de CSS en castellano
Asunto: Re: [Ovillo] onContextMenu


De Marco Recuenco, Angel Daniel escribió:
 Hola!
 
 os quería preguntar si es posible deshabilitar por medio
 de estilos el menú contextual que se activa con el botón
 derecho del ratón; 

Respuesta corta: no, no se puede.

Respuesta larga: deshabilitar mi botón derecho supone un atentado en 
toda regla contra mi libertad como usuario. (¿Y qué mayor violencia que 
la que se ejerce contra el espíritu?)

Por otra parte, así a bote pronto, diría que `onContextMenu` es un 
evento propietario de IE y, en cualquier caso, si pretendes proteger 
algo mediante dicho truquillo, no lo vas a conseguir.

Salud,
Choan

PS: Si te apetece mandar alguna URL que aplique dicha técnica, estaré 
encantado de demostrarte que no sirve de nada.

 el caso es que la cosa funciona si en la etiqueta body de
 la página le escribes onContextMenu=return false.. esto se
 puede escribir en el estilo body de alguna forma para que no
 haya que ponerlo en todas las páginas?
 
 gracias.

-- 
Mundo Du. Cuentos breves, relatos sorprendentes
http://du.lacalabaza.net/

Dizque. Cosas que me van y me vienen
http://dizque.lacalabaza.net/

___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://ovillo.org/mailman/listinfo/ovillo
___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://ovillo.org/mailman/listinfo/ovillo


Re: [Ovillo] onContextMenu

2005-04-20 Por tema Alejandro Cuesta
Que yo sepa no se puede.

Eso va en contra de la accesibilidad y la usabilidad
en el sentido de que disminuye el control por parte
del usuario, e invade competencias que deben ser
controladas únicamente por el agente de usuario. 

CSS es para presentar un documento con un aspecto
concreto, no es para influir en el programa que lo
presenta. 

Te imaginas un documento word que desactive el menú
del botón derecho mediante estilos ?

- Alex -


--- De Marco Recuenco, Angel Daniel
[EMAIL PROTECTED] wrote:
 Hola!
 
 os quería preguntar si es posible deshabilitar por
 medio
 de estilos el menú contextual que se activa con el
 botón
 derecho del ratón; 
 
 el caso es que la cosa funciona si en la etiqueta
 body de
 la página le escribes onContextMenu=return false..
 esto se
 puede escribir en el estilo body de alguna forma
 para que no
 haya que ponerlo en todas las páginas?
 
 gracias.
 ___
 Lista de distribución Ovillo
 Para escribir a la lista, envia un correo a
 Ovillo@lists.ovillo.org
 Puedes modificar tus datos o desuscribirte en la
 siguiente dirección:
 http://ovillo.org/mailman/listinfo/ovillo
 





__ 
Renovamos el Correo Yahoo!: ¡250 MB GRATIS! 
Nuevos servicios, más seguridad 
http://correo.yahoo.es
___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://ovillo.org/mailman/listinfo/ovillo


RE: [Ovillo] onContextMenu

2005-04-20 Por tema Alejandro Cuesta
Perdona, pero mi agente de usuario, es decir, mi
navegador, es mío, y no te permito que desactives mi
botón derecho con el que puedo añadir la página a
Favoritos, o ejecutar otras acciones que necesito. Yo
solo quiero ver tu página web. Qué clase de libertad
reclamas para permitirte con derecho a manipular los
programas de los usuarios como si fuera un virus? 

Y si tu cliente cree que el menú contextual es
innecesario y poco usable, deberías ser tú quién le
explique que está en un gran error por dos simples
razones: 1) esa no es la finalidad de la web, y 2) por
ello, técnicamente no se puede hacer de ninguna forma.
Y esa es la respuesta a tu pregunta técnica. Lo demás
no es una opinión, es una explicación de porqué no se
puede. Ningún comprador de un piso impone al
arquitecto donde tiene que poner las columnas del
edificio.
 
Y si tanto necesitas hacer eso, pues utiliza un
script, que es un tema que queda fuera de esta lista.
Aunque de todas formas no te servirá para nada, porque
se puede desactivar, del mismo modo que también se
puede desactivar CSS. Los navegadores están pensados
para ser controlados por su usuario, no por las webs
situadas al otro lado.

Yo creo que tu pregunta ha sido respondida y
re-que-te-explicada por más de una persona. Si lo has
entendido, me alegro. Si no lo has entendido es una
pena.

Un saludo.

- Alex -




--- De Marco Recuenco, Angel Daniel
[EMAIL PROTECTED] wrote:
 ..el diseño web no sólo se hace para servicios de
 caracter público, existen 
 multitud de aplicaciones de cliente ligero que se
 desarrollan 
 para ser manejadas mediante un navegador en la que
 las acciones de
 los usuarios están estrictamente determinadas,así
 las funciones 
 propias de los navegadores no sólo no son útiles,
 sino que son 
 innecesarias, los navegadores están pensados para
 muchas 
 cosas.. y para muchas menos.
 
 ..pero, que me detengan!!! que me detengan!!!
 
 el agente usuario en su caracter de agente sin porra
 
 puede diseñar sus propias aplicaciones con las
 limitaciones
 que la tecnología tiene, si existe una función que
 permite
 deshabilitar una función que repito el cliente en su
 aplicación 
 la cree INNECESARIA y nada USABLE, a quién estamos
 atentando,
 a la ciberlibertad que los navegadores y sus
 desarrolladores 
 han establecido?.. de todas formas, y en el caso de
 que la cosa
 fuera pública es uno mismo ejerciendo su libertad el
 que 
 establece si su web es más o menos accesible o más o
 menos
 usable, pero creo que esto es parte de un debate que
 no forma
 parte de esta lista, y sí de filosofía cibernética,
 si es que 
 existe..
 
 espero que nadie se ofenda por escuchar también mis
 opiniones a
 algo que yo previamente no he pedido, mi pregunta
 era de carácter
 técnico y no teórico.. he agradecido la respuesta
 técnica y he 
 respondido a la opinión con mi opinión.
 
 agradezco la función de esta lista y como parte
 integrante de
 ella espero poder aportar lo que esté en mi mano, en
 mi cabeza,
 y en mis entrañas.. gracias de todo corazón. 
 
 
 
 -Mensaje original-
 De: [EMAIL PROTECTED]
 [mailto:[EMAIL PROTECTED] nombre de
 Alejandro Cuesta
 Enviado el: miércoles, 20 de abril de 2005 14:13
 Para: Ovillo, la lista de CSS en castellano
 Asunto: Re: [Ovillo] onContextMenu
 
 
 Que yo sepa no se puede.
 
 Eso va en contra de la accesibilidad y la usabilidad
 en el sentido de que disminuye el control por parte
 del usuario, e invade competencias que deben ser
 controladas únicamente por el agente de usuario. 
 
 CSS es para presentar un documento con un aspecto
 concreto, no es para influir en el programa que lo
 presenta. 
 
 Te imaginas un documento word que desactive el menú
 del botón derecho mediante estilos ?
 
 - Alex -
 
 
 --- De Marco Recuenco, Angel Daniel
 [EMAIL PROTECTED] wrote:
  Hola!
  
  os quería preguntar si es posible deshabilitar por
  medio
  de estilos el menú contextual que se activa con el
  botón
  derecho del ratón; 
  
  el caso es que la cosa funciona si en la etiqueta
  body de
  la página le escribes onContextMenu=return
 false..
  esto se
  puede escribir en el estilo body de alguna forma
  para que no
  haya que ponerlo en todas las páginas?
  
  gracias.
  ___
  Lista de distribución Ovillo
  Para escribir a la lista, envia un correo a
  Ovillo@lists.ovillo.org
  Puedes modificar tus datos o desuscribirte en la
  siguiente dirección:
  http://ovillo.org/mailman/listinfo/ovillo
  
 
 
   
   
   
 __ 
 Renovamos el Correo Yahoo!: ¡250 MB GRATIS! 
 Nuevos servicios, más seguridad 
 http://correo.yahoo.es
 ___
 Lista de distribución Ovillo
 Para escribir a la lista, envia un correo a
 Ovillo@lists.ovillo.org
 Puedes modificar tus datos o desuscribirte en la
 siguiente dirección:
 http://ovillo.org/mailman/listinfo/ovillo
 ___
 Lista de

RE: [Ovillo] onContextMenu

2005-04-20 Por tema Alejandro Cuesta
 --- De Marco Recuenco, Angel Daniel
[EMAIL PROTECTED] escribió: 
 Espero que haya quedado claro, no entiendo todo este
 revuelo que
 me parece más propio de inquisidores que se erigen
 en guardianes
 de no se qué principios y que, en cualquier caso en
 esta lista 
 no tendría que tener cabida esta discusión, ya que
 es algo
 estrictamente de usabilidad.
 

Mira, en esto estoy de acuerdo, ...en esta lista no
tendría que tener cabida esta discusión..., ya que lo
que preguntas para nada tiene que ver con CSS. 

Lo siento, pero los navegadores son para navegar y
tienen sus limitaciones. Te vuelvo a sugerir que
utilices Javascript, porque es así como la mayoría
deshabilita el menú contextual.

- Alex -




__ 
Renovamos el Correo Yahoo!: ¡250 MB GRATIS! 
Nuevos servicios, más seguridad 
http://correo.yahoo.es
___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://ovillo.org/mailman/listinfo/ovillo


RE: [Ovillo] onContextMenu

2005-04-20 Por tema Iban Rodriguez
OnContextMenu es javascript, es por ello que no se puede poner en CSS. Es un
evento que se lanza cuando un usuario llama al menú contextual, es decir, el
del menú derecho del ratón.
Y en CSS tampoco hay nada que permita capar funcionalidades del navegador.
Simplemente formatea el contenido.

En definitiva, no, no se puede hacer con CSS, y sí, tendrás que ponerlo en
todos los body.

__
?php
$Autor = Iban Rodriguez;
// Programador, THE MOVIE
?
www.themovie.org


-Mensaje original-
De: [EMAIL PROTECTED]
[mailto:[EMAIL PROTECTED] nombre de Alejandro Cuesta
Enviado el: miércoles, 20 de abril de 2005 17:37
Para: Ovillo, la lista de CSS en castellano
Asunto: RE: [Ovillo] onContextMenu

 --- De Marco Recuenco, Angel Daniel
[EMAIL PROTECTED] escribió:
 Espero que haya quedado claro, no entiendo todo este
 revuelo que
 me parece más propio de inquisidores que se erigen
 en guardianes
 de no se qué principios y que, en cualquier caso en
 esta lista
 no tendría que tener cabida esta discusión, ya que
 es algo
 estrictamente de usabilidad.


Mira, en esto estoy de acuerdo, ...en esta lista no
tendría que tener cabida esta discusión..., ya que lo
que preguntas para nada tiene que ver con CSS.

Lo siento, pero los navegadores son para navegar y
tienen sus limitaciones. Te vuelvo a sugerir que
utilices Javascript, porque es así como la mayoría
deshabilita el menú contextual.

- Alex -




__
Renovamos el Correo Yahoo!: ¡250 MB GRATIS!
Nuevos servicios, más seguridad
http://correo.yahoo.es
___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ección:
http://ovillo.org/mailman/listinfo/ovillo

___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://ovillo.org/mailman/listinfo/ovillo


Re: [Ovillo] onContextMenu

2005-04-20 Por tema Olivier Georg
Eso en CSS2, porque en CSS3 sí se podrá incluir js.

Olivier

- Original Message -
From: Iban Rodriguez [EMAIL PROTECTED]
To: Ovillo, la lista de CSS en castellano ovillo@lists.ovillo.org
Sent: Wednesday, April 20, 2005 5:56 PM
Subject: RE: [Ovillo] onContextMenu


 OnContextMenu es javascript, es por ello que no se puede poner en CSS. Es
un
 evento que se lanza cuando un usuario llama al menú contextual, es decir,
el
 del menú derecho del ratón.
 Y en CSS tampoco hay nada que permita capar funcionalidades del
navegador.
 Simplemente formatea el contenido.

 En definitiva, no, no se puede hacer con CSS, y sí, tendrás que ponerlo en
 todos los body.

 __
 ?php
 $Autor = Iban Rodriguez;
 // Programador, THE MOVIE
 ?
 www.themovie.org


 -Mensaje original-
 De: [EMAIL PROTECTED]
 [mailto:[EMAIL PROTECTED] nombre de Alejandro Cuesta
 Enviado el: miércoles, 20 de abril de 2005 17:37
 Para: Ovillo, la lista de CSS en castellano
 Asunto: RE: [Ovillo] onContextMenu

  --- De Marco Recuenco, Angel Daniel
 [EMAIL PROTECTED] escribió:
  Espero que haya quedado claro, no entiendo todo este
  revuelo que
  me parece más propio de inquisidores que se erigen
  en guardianes
  de no se qué principios y que, en cualquier caso en
  esta lista
  no tendría que tener cabida esta discusión, ya que
  es algo
  estrictamente de usabilidad.
 

 Mira, en esto estoy de acuerdo, ...en esta lista no
 tendría que tener cabida esta discusión..., ya que lo
 que preguntas para nada tiene que ver con CSS.

 Lo siento, pero los navegadores son para navegar y
 tienen sus limitaciones. Te vuelvo a sugerir que
 utilices Javascript, porque es así como la mayoría
 deshabilita el menú contextual.

 - Alex -




 __
 Renovamos el Correo Yahoo!: ¡250 MB GRATIS!
 Nuevos servicios, más seguridad
 http://correo.yahoo.es
 ___
 Lista de distribución Ovillo
 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
 Puedes modificar tus datos o desuscribirte en la siguiente dirección:
 http://ovillo.org/mailman/listinfo/ovillo

 ___
 Lista de distribución Ovillo
 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
 Puedes modificar tus datos o desuscribirte en la siguiente dirección:
http://ovillo.org/mailman/listinfo/ovillo


___
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://ovillo.org/mailman/listinfo/ovillo